Wentling announces $5 million in aid for senior housing project

HARRISBURG – Rep. Parke Wentling (R-Mercer) announced today that the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ency (PHFA) has awarded more than $5 million in aid for the School House Commons project. This initiative aims to build and renovate 37 one-bedroom and four two-bedroom units for seniors aged 62 and above.

“I’m glad to have played a role in bringing funding back home to Mercer County to make this important project happen in Greenville,” Wentling said. “Thanks to this aid from PHFA, and the hard work of Hudson Companies, qualified seniors will have access to housing that won’t break the bank.”

The PHFA aid includes over $1.4 million in tax credits and an additional $3.7 million in funding from the Pennsylvania Housing Tax Credit (PHTC), Pennsylvania Housing Affordability and Rehabilitation Enhancement funding, and PennHOMES funding, primarily provided through the federal Home Investment Partnership Program.
